Crunchy Monkey Peanut Butter-Banana Sticks

Ingredients
- 1/2 cup chunky-style peanut butter
- 2 tablespoons honey (a couple of drizzles)
- 1 cup fancy granola with nuts and raisins
- 2 large bananas
- 4 ice cream sticks or chopsticks
Serves 4
Preparation
Heat the peanut butter in the microwave on high for 20 seconds to loosen it, then stir the honey into it.
Place the granola into a food processor and lightly process to crush up the granola, nuts and raisins.
Peel and cut each banana in half across the middle. Insert a popsicle or chopstick into the cut end of each half-banana. Spread one side of each banana stick with 1/4 of the peanut sauce, then coat liberally with spoonfuls of granola, gently pressing it into the peanut butter.
Eat the bananas right off the sticks, but serve on a plate to catch the crumbs!
